This print by Eric Woods captures the essence of Liverpool's Royal Liver Building on its 100th anniversary. Constructed in 1911, this iconic architectural masterpiece is celebrated through a mesmerizing 3D Macula light show with the theme "Spider on Spiders Web". The image showcases the building illuminated against the dark night sky, creating a stunning contrast that highlights its grandeur. The Royal Liver Building stands tall as a symbol of Liverpool's rich history and cultural heritage. Its intricate design and majestic presence have made it an integral part of the city's skyline.
